PLOT:
Standing in the school building and staring at the frozen dead faces of Cain and Slade's latest Pheno test subjects, Cass is shocked to find that their murderer appears to be a sister of hers.
Much like Batgirl, Marque too was once one of David Cain's students. Although she swears she never let the murderer into her head, she accepted his training learning everything she could before
eventually turning on him. Now she seeks to put an end to Cain and Slade's Pheno experiments.
Batgirl tries to convince Marque that they are on the same mission but Marque harkens back to one of Cain's first lessons - "trust is a ghost!" The two tumble through a plate glass window and begin duking it out
on the basketball court outside the school building. Eventually Cassandra is able to get the upper hand and proves her honor by not taking the opportunity to kill Marque.
Since Batgirl obviously cannot trust Marque enough to let her into the Bat-Cave the two part company with the plan to meet up the next night and exchange whatever information they're able to find in Cain and Slade's backgrounds
that might help them find their next target. Before leaving, Cass tries to make Marque promise not to kill anyone but Marque doesn't listen.
Batgirl returns to the cave and begins running her tests when the Oracle appears on the computer screen. Barbara tries to remind Cass that she doesn't have to do this alone and that killing the men will not make her feel any better. But Barbara also
fully understands the need to take matters into your own hands. So she promises to delete any traces of Cassandra's computer activity so that Bruce won't know what she's been up to. Meanwhile, Cass is also running a blood test of some sort on the computer as well.
Later while looking up information at the How you Bean coffee shop, Cassandra runs into an old schoolmate Sal. Sal writes down his number and tells Cassandra to call him before he leaves town in a couple weeks. But
a new date isn't the only positive thing about the afternoon - Cassandra seems to have found a common link in the backgrounds of Cain and Slade!
That night Cassandra returns to the basketball court where she finds Marque washing blood off her hands. Although the two had both found people who might have been connected to Slade and Cain in the past, Marque says that her
interview subject didn't seem to know anything. With Marquee's witness
incapacitated, the two girls pursue the lead Cassandra found - a chemist from Congola.
Batgirl and Marque arrive at the Narrows Island Federal Penitentiary where the chemist, Klaus-Josef Hannemaier is being held. Though he appears to be senile, the girls are able to get enough information from
Hannemaier to infer that
he had helped Cain and Slade stabilize the Pheno compound. This means that the women Marque had murdered were practically complete test subjects. When Batgirl and Marque leave,
Klaus lets down his ruse and immediately demands to use one of his phone calls.
When Batgirl and Marque return to the school something seems off. The shattered glass from the window earlier is missing. Before Batgirl can piece together the puzzle, the two are electrified by a hidden current. Before passing out the girls find themselves
staring up at two very familiar orange boots...
